Tag Archives: web

RapidSSL証明書購入からApache / Postfix / Dovecotでの設定まで

HTTPS / SMTP over SSL/TLS (SMTPS) / IMAP over SSL/TLS (IMAPS) / POP over SSL/TLS (POPS) を使用するには署名つきSSL証明書が必要だ。利用者が限られたサービスでは自己署名した、いわゆるオレオレ証明書でSSLを実現することも不可能ではないが、ボクは年間10.95ドル(1,115円)でRapidSSLを利用している。

RapidSSLはGeoTrustの最安ブランドで、GeoTrustはSymantec(旧VeriSign)グループのひとつである。メール一通だけの確認なので手軽な一方、信用度はそれほど高くはないが、どこが発行しているかどうかを気にしてSSL通信しているユーザーはほとんどいないので、EV証明書(Webブラウザーのアドレス・バーに所有者名が出るやつ)ほどはいらないのであれば、悪くない選択だろう。

RapidSSLのルート証明書は2010年10月10日以降 GeoTrust Global CA だが、それ以前と同様に Equifax Secure Certificate Authority をルート証明書にするクロス・ルート設定をすることもできる。携帯電話も最近の機種であればこの2つのどちらにも対応しているが、一部のAndroidがなにげに GeoTrust Global CA に対応していないので、Equifax Secure Certificate Authority をルート証明書にしたほうが良いだろう。会社から支給されている DOCOMO LG Optimus chat L-04C は Android 2.2.2 にも関わらず、CACertManで確認したところ GeoTrust Global CA には対応していなかった。Apple iPhoneApple: iOS 3.x: 信用できるルート証明書の一覧 によると、少なくとも iOS 3 からはどちらの証明書にも対応している。

Continue reading RapidSSL証明書購入からApache / Postfix / Dovecotでの設定まで

Oracle OpenWorld Tokyo 2012 | JavaOne Tokyo 2012 お申込み受付開始

Oracle OpenWorld Tokyo 2012JavaOne Tokyo 2012 のお申込み受付が始まりました。Oracle OpenWorld Tokyo 2012 は4月4日から6日まで、JavaOne Tokyo 2012 は4月4日から5日まで、それぞれ六本木ヒルズなどで開催されます。参加費は Oracle OpenWorld Tokyo 2012 が無料で、JavaOne Tokyo 2012 が5,250円です。

以下のバナーからお申込みいただき、招待コードに「2715」を入力していただくと、Oracle OpenWorld Tokyo 2012 では Leaders Club メンバーとして招待者限定セッションに参加できるようになります。JavaOne Tokyo 2012 では招待コードを入れるメリットは参加者の皆さまには特にないのですが……、私がほんの少し上司にほめられるかもしれません。

Oracle OpenWorld Tokyo 2012

JavaOne Tokyo 2012

CentOS 5.6 で PHP 5.3.6 にアップグレード

新しいメジャー・リリースである WordPress 3.2 がリリースされたけど、このバージョンから動作要件が変更され、PHP 5.2.4 以上 / MySQL 5.0 以上が必要になった。しかし、このブログで使っている CentOS 5.6 に含まれる最新のPHPは5.1.6で要件を満たせていないので、今回はこのPHPをアップグレードすることにした。Red Hat Enterprise Linux (RHEL) / Scientific Linux (SL) / Oracle Linux でも同様の方法でアップグレードできるだろう。ちなみに、CentOS 5.6 に含まれる最新のMySQLは5.0.77なので、今回の要件を満たしている。

CentOS 5.6 で使える PHP 5.2.4 以上のパッケージはさまざまなサード・パーティ・リポジトリにも存在するが、今回は以下のものを候補とした。

  • CentOS公式が提供するc5-testingリポジトリのphp-5.2.10-1.el5.centos
  • CentOS公式が提供するupdatesリポジトリのphp53-5.3.3-1.el5_6.1
  • IUS Community Project が提供するiusリポジトリのphp53u-5.3.6-1.ius.el5

IUS Community Project はPHP公式ダウンロード・ページからもリンクされており、2006年から最新のPHPとMySQLを Red Hat Enterprise Linux(とそのクローン)に提供することを目標とした組織で、数あるリポジトリの中でも信頼できると判断した。一方、PHP 5.2 はすでにサポート終了しており、しかも最終バージョンの5.2.17でもないphp-5.2.10-1.el5.centosを選ぶのも少し気が引けたので、まずは PHP 5.3 をインストールすることにした。

Continue reading CentOS 5.6 で PHP 5.3.6 にアップグレード

複眼中心をWordPressに移行

Hello again。

ボクがブログを始めた2004年1月頃は Movable Type が定番だったけど、その静的ページ生成に嫌気がさして2004年11月にP_BLOGに移行したものの、そのP_BLOGも2008年10月で開発終了。時代の定番はすでにWordPressになっていたので、それに移行しようしようと思い続けて3年半。ついにWordPressへの移行が完了した。

WordPressへの移行がこのタイミングで可能になったのは、WordPress 3.0 の新機能であるテンプレート継承によるところが大きい。これによって独自のテンプレートを使用するときも全てのページを作成する必要がなく、差分に集中するだけで済んだ。また、この継承されることを前提とした新しいデフォルト・テンプレート「Twenty Ten」も良くできており、9割の部分がCSS変更だけで済み、HTMLを変更したのはブロック要素の順序を変えたいためなのがほとんだった。これによってHTML自体のアップグレードの9割が Twenty Ten 開発チームに委譲できたようなもので、管理面でも大きなメリットがあるだろう。

Continue reading 複眼中心をWordPressに移行

Googleユーザーの友達

唐突だけど、あなたは友達少ないでしょ? グサッ。Eストアーの調査によると、Googleを利用するユーザーはYahoo!を利用するユ−ザーより友達が少ないとのこと! なんつーアンケート調査だよ(笑)

Google Analytics によると、この複眼中心を見ている方の63%はGoogleからの参照なので、最低でも3人に2人は友達が少ない人、15人に1人は友達ゼロということになったよ! 友達を増やしたい人は今すぐ色気のないGoogleなんて窓から投げ捨てて、ハッピーでポップなYahoo!に乗り換えて「Yahoo!の新しいトップページ試した?」と周りの人に話しかけてみよう!

<

p>しかし、なんだ。“仲良しの友達” の定義が曖昧とは言え、GoogleにしろYahoo!にしろ平均3人って、そんなもんなの……?